The stable and efficient operation of the drum vibrating screen stems from its scientifically designed structure, where core components work together to form a complete screening system. The drum body, the core of the equipment, consists of a screen, a support frame, and a drum shell. The screen aperture can be precisely customized according to specific screening needs, which is the foundation for separating materials of different particle sizes. The vibration device is key to improving screening efficiency. It typically consists of a motor, eccentric blocks, or vibration springs. By generating stable vibrations, it ensures uniform material distribution within the drum, preventing localized accumulation that could lead to insufficient screening. The drive unit, consisting of a motor and reducer, powers the drum’s rotation and precisely controls its speed to adapt to the screening rhythm of different materials. The support system, employing a combination of a support frame and bearings, stably supports the drum while reducing frictional losses during operation, ensuring smooth equipment operation. The inlet and outlet form an orderly material flow channel, with the outlet designed according to particle size classification to ensure accurate discharge of materials of different specifications. Furthermore, the sealing device effectively prevents dust leakage during screening, maintaining a clean working environment and meeting the requirements of modern green industrial production.
